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, General Health Professions and Clinical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ello has authored 69 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 25 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 20 papers in General Health Professions and 15 papers in Clinical Psychology. Recurrent topics in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ello's work include Intergenerational Family Dynamics and Caregiving (12 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(12 papers) and Social and Demographic Issues in Germany (8 papers).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ello is often cited by papers focused on Intergenerational Family Dynamics and Caregiving (12 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(12 papers) and Social and Demographic Issues in Germany (8 papers).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, United Kingdom and Germany. Pasqualina Perrig‐Chiello's co-authors include Walter J. Perrig, Sara Hutchison, Davide Morselli, Rolf Ehrsam, François Höpflinger, H. Bischoff, Alan Tyndall, Reinhard Vonthein, H.B. Stähelin and Robert Theiler and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Journal of Affective Disorders.
